How to Reset iPhone 13 to Factory Settings
Resetting your iPhone 13 to factory settings will erase all data on the device, returning it to its original state as if it were brand new. This process can be helpful if you are experiencing software issues or preparing to sell your phone.
Step 1: Backup Your Data
Before resetting your iPhone 13, make sure to back up all your important data, such as contacts, photos, and messages, to iCloud or your computer.
Backing up your data ensures that you don’t lose any important information during the reset process.
Step 2: Access Settings
Open the Settings app on your iPhone 13 and tap on General.
After selecting General, scroll down and tap on Reset.
Step 3: Reset All Settings
In the Reset menu, tap on Erase All Content and Settings.
You may be prompted to enter your passcode and Apple ID password to confirm the reset.
After completing these steps, your iPhone 13 will begin the reset process, which may take some time to complete.
What Happens After You Reset Your iPhone 13
Once you have successfully reset your iPhone 13 to factory settings, the device will reboot, and you will be greeted with the initial setup screen as if you were activating a new phone. You can choose to set up your iPhone as a new device or restore it from a backup.

Frequently Asked Questions
Can I reset my iPhone 13 without a passcode?
No, you will need to enter your passcode to reset your iPhone 13 to factory settings.
Will resetting my iPhone 13 delete my Apple ID?
Resetting your iPhone 13 will not delete your Apple ID, but you will need to enter your Apple ID password to reactivate the device.
How long does it take to reset an iPhone 13?
The reset process can take anywhere from a few minutes to an hour, depending on your device’s storage capacity.
Will resetting my iPhone 13 remove the iOS update?
No, resetting your iPhone 13 will not remove the iOS update. Your device will remain on the same iOS version.
Can I stop the reset process once it has started?
Once you have initiated the reset process, it cannot be stopped, so make sure you are ready to proceed before confirming.
